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Netherfield to Llandrindod start from as little as £22.20

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Netherfield to Llandrindod start from £90.30 one way, or £91.50 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Netherfield to Llandrindod are available for £126.60 one way, or £134.40 return

Facilities and Amenities

Though the station might not boast extensive facilities, it does cater to essential needs. There’s no ticket office, but ticket machines are available for purchasing and collecting your tickets. While smartcards aren’t issued here, they can be validated, and there’s an induction loop available for those with hearing impairments.

If you require assistance, there’s a help point at the station. However, it's worth noting that the station lacks step-free access, which is something to keep in mind if mobility is an issue—contact the helpline to arrange passenger assistance in advance. While CCTV is operational for added security, facilities such as toilets, waiting rooms, seating, and refreshments are not available on-site.

Station Facilities and Accessibility

Visitors to Llandrindod train station will find a range of facilities to ensure a comfortable journey. The station offers step-free access on both platforms, which is comfortably reached by a footbridge equipped with ramps. While the station lacks ticket machines and smartcard facilities, a ticket office is available during the week from 08:00 to 15:00, providing assistance and ticket sales. Although there's no luggage storage or concierge services like lost property, the station maintains an accessible seating area and induction loops to aid travelers with hearing impairments.

Travel Connections and Services

Beyond the platform, Llandrindod train station provides several onward travel options. A taxi rank is conveniently situated adjacent to the station building on Waterloo Road. For those whose trains may be disrupted, a rail replacement bus service can be accessed right at the station entrance. Although there are no cycle hire facilities at the station, the town itself offers numerous bike trails for keen cyclists to discover the surrounding natural beauty.
